Предлагаю при выполнении автоматического резервного копирования упаковывать файл резервной копии в архив.
Для чего нужно: Даже при использовании обычного zip архива с алгоритмом Deflate удаётся уменьшить размер файла в 5 раз, при использовании 7z с LZMA2 - в 6-7 раз. Это позволяет существенно экономить дисковое пространство на сервере. Особенно это актуально при использовании арендованных VPS для сервера ЛЭРС, а так же при размещении резервных копий на облачных хранилищах.
Думаю, что в задачи ЛЭРС УЧЁТ это не входит.
У нас есть удаление файлов резервных копий, которое работает с кучей разных условий. Сервер БД и сервер ЛЭРС должен стоять на одном компьютере, должен быть доступ к папке, и так далее. Если настроить что-то не так, ошибок не выдаётся, но система не работает. Точно такие же ограничения будут и в случае сжатия.
В случае работы на Postgres мы вообще не можем сделать резервную копию из сервера. Поэтому, этот механизм так же работать не будет.
Гораздо проще поместить в диспетчер задач powershell скрипт, который будет сжимать файлы по определённому алгоритму. Его можно запускать на сервере БД, и работать он будет даже если сервер ЛЭРС и сервер БД стоят на разных компьютерах.